Understanding Defense Methods
Understanding the various defense strategies your lawyer could use is critical to efficiently navigating your case. Each method depends upon the specifics of the charges you're dealing with and the proof against you. Let's explore what you need to recognize.
First off, if there's a lack of proof, your attorney may argue that the prosecution hasn't satisfied its burden of proof. Keep in mind, it's not your job to verify virtue; it's the prosecutor's work to verify guilt beyond a reasonable uncertainty. If they can't, you need to be acquitted.
Another common method is self-defense, specifically in cases involving fees like assault or murder. If you were safeguarding yourself, your attorney could utilize this approach to warrant your activities lawfully. This calls for verifying that your perception of hazard was reasonable which your response was in proportion to that hazard.
Occasionally, your protection might include doubting the legitimacy of how proof was obtained. If police broke your legal rights during the investigation, evidence might be reduced, which can considerably compromise the prosecution's instance.
Finally, your lawyer might bargain a plea bargain if it offers your benefit. This typically occurs if the proof against you is strong yet there are alleviating aspects that could bring about decreased costs or sentencing.
Understanding these methods helps you discuss your situation better with your attorney.
